ACCIDENTS NEWS

  • A fire at 415 11th St. NW on Sunday caused residents to be trapped on the second and third floors when a man jumped from a third story window, with fire crews rescuing two individuals for smoke inhalation plus declaring the building uninhabitable.  FOX 8

BUSINESS NEWS

  • Surgeon Nathan Hieb—who works at Cleveland Clinic Mercy Hospital—opened The Mayflower tea and coffee shop at 1117 Wertz Ave NW, giving Canton residents a new local spot for drinks.  The Repository

FINANCE NEWS

  • Lottery officials said the winning numbers 1, 12, 14, 18, 69 and Powerball 2 brought prizes to thousands of Ohio winners from the drawing held Saturday, April 27 in Kentucky — the grand prize includes a cash option of $77.3 million. They noted the jackpot now resets to $20 million with a cash option of $9.2 million as the next drawing is set for tonight at 10:59 p.m.  WKYC
